One summer day, a group of bugs gathered together to play a game of hide and seek. The first bug to be "it" was a little ladybug who eagerly counted to ten while the other bugs scurried off to hide.

The ladybug finished counting and started to search for the other bugs. She looked under leaves and behind tree trunks, but she couldn't find anyone. Just as she was starting to get frustrated, she heard a tiny voice say, "Psst! Over here!"

The ladybug looked around and spotted a small ant waving at her from inside a crack in the ground. "You found me!" the ant exclaimed.

Feeling proud of herself, the ladybug continued to search for the other bugs. She looked high and low, but nobody seemed to be around. Suddenly, she heard a loud buzzing noise, and a big fat fly flew right into her face.

"Hey, watch where you're going!" the ladybug exclaimed.

"Sorry, sorry," the fly apologized. "I was just trying to get away from the spider. He's been chasing me all morning!"

The ladybug thought for a moment and then had an idea. "I know where we can hide," she said. "Follow me!"

The ladybug led the fly and the ant to a nearby flower patch, where they all squeezed inside one of the flowers. The spider searched high and low but couldn't find them, and soon gave up and went away.

The bugs all cheered and high-fived each other. "That was close," the ant said.

"Yeah, we really bugged out," the fly joked.

The ladybug rolled her eyes but couldn't help but smile. It had been a fun game, even if they had cheated a little bit.
